MARK COLLAR

Colorado Department of Public Health and Environment

Project Manager, Federal Facilities Unit, Hazardous Materials and Waste Management Division

 

Mark is a Project Manager in the Federal Facilities Unit of the Colorado Department of Public Health and Environment’s (CDPHE) Hazardous Materials and Waste Management Division’s (HMWMD) Remediation Program. He has been with the Remediation Program since 2021 where he works closely with Department of Defense (DoD) counterparts overseeing investigations and remedial actions under RCRA and CERCLA framework for a wide variety of contaminants at federal facility sites in Colorado. Prior to joining CDPHE, Mark spent 13 years as a consultant with a focus on project management and providing direct client support, regulatory coordination, and field work planning/reporting primarily for commercial and industrial facilities. Mark is a registered Professional Geologist in California and Wyoming and also a California Certified Hydrogeologist. Mark received a Master’s degree in Hydrologic Science and Engineering from Colorado School of Mines and a Bachelor’s degree in Geology from the University of California, Santa Barbara.
